EFJohnson Technologies, Inc. Highlights New Products at FDIC 2009

Company to demonstrate Project 25 compliant two-way radios for fire fighters

Irving, TX – EF Johnson Technologies, Inc. today announced that it will highlight its award-winning ES Series of Project 25 radios and new products including the Lightning™ Control Head for the 5300 Series Mobile Radio and the Discover™ GPS Speaker Microphone for the 5100 ES Series Portable Radio at the Fire Department Instructors Conference (FDIC) April 23 - 25, 2009 at the Indiana Convention Center.

“Our award-winning ES Series radios are a good fit for fire fighters due to the second-generation Enhanced (AMBE+2) Project 25 Vocoder for superior voice quality and reduction of background noise, submersible color housings, solid construction, and large knobs,” said Michael Jalbert, president and chief executive officer of EF Johnson Technologies, Inc. “Our new Lightning Control Head is the brightest and clearest display on the market, and can be seen even in bright sunlight. Fire fighters will find our new Discover GPS Speaker Microphone ideal for search and rescue missions, because it enables you to see in real time the location of your search teams and complements our portable radios.” FDIC is the largest showcase and exhibition of fire equipment in the world, Jalbert added.

About EF Johnson Technologies, Inc.
Headquartered in Irving, Texas, EF Johnson Technologies, Inc. focuses on innovating, developing and marketing the highest quality secure communications solutions to organizations whose mission is to protect and save lives. The Company’s customers include first responders in public safety and public service, the federal government, and industrial organizations.
